What is the purpose of DoDI 6055.12?

Explanation:
The purpose of DoDI 6055.12, which stands for Department of Defense Instruction 6055.12, is to establish policy for the Hearing Conservation Program across the Department of Defense. This regulation is designed to ensure that service members are protected from excessive noise in their working environments, which can lead to hearing loss or impairment over time. By applying uniformly to the tri-services, it sets forth the necessary measures and guidelines for implementing effective hearing conservation practices, ultimately aiming to protect the hearing health of military personnel. This comprehensive approach ensures consistency in how hearing conservation is managed within the different branches of the military.
